Output 66373f544f81d40792e60950b2c37b3b574dca0fafb1451fc9ea47c9c321d1a3:0

value
879662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a45a9e703431abf95a1f1fd6a75acac5ddaf20dd OP_EQUAL
address
3Gg3JKFVJYCAbRrghoMrnv7wgXcZYZeSqZ
transaction
66373f544f81d40792e60950b2c37b3b574dca0fafb1451fc9ea47c9c321d1a3
spent
true